How to get from Portsea to Jackass Flat by bus and train?
From Portsea to Jackass Flat by bus and train
To get from Portsea to Jackass Flat in Melbourne, you’ll need to take one bus line and 2 train lines: take the 788 bus from Point Nepean National Park Entrance/Point Nepean Rd (Portsea) station to Frankston Railway Station/Young St (Frankston) station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the FRANKSTON train and finally take the MELBOURNE - BENDIGO VIA SUNBURY train from Southern Cross station to Eaglehawk station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 6 hr 57 min. The ride fare is A$24.54.
